Tai Chi is often recommended as a way to improve flexibility in the elderly. Below are before-and-after flexibility ratings (on a 1 to 10 scale, 10 being most flexible) for a random sample of 8 men in their 80’s who took Tai Chi lessons for six months. (Data is in the Picture) (a) Researchers would like to estimate the true mean difference (after – before) in flexibility rating for men in their 80’s who take Tai Chi lessons for 6 months. Determine if the conditions for constructing a 95% confidence interval are met. (b) The 95% confidence interval is (0.0488, 2.26). Does this interval provide convincing evidence that taking Tai Chi lessons for 6 months increases flexibility for men like these?
